Edinburg-Mcallen Veterinary Services PC
Edinburg-Mcallen Veterinary Services PC is a Hospitals company at Edinburg,Texas,United States , Tel is (956)383-5080,address is 3620 West Freddy Gonzalez Drive.You can find more Edinburg-Mcallen Veterinary Services PC contact info like fax,email,website below.